How Standing Water Extraction Actually Works
Proper Standing Water Extraction is more than just a quick fix. It’s a meticulous process that needs specialized equipment and expertise. Our team follows a step-by-step process to ensure your property is thoroughly dried and restored to its original condition. We take pride in our attention to detail and commitment to getting the job done right.
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
We’ll conduct a thorough assessment to identify the source and extent of the damage.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and pinpoint areas that need attention.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action for extraction and repair.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use a combination of pumps and vacuum equipment to extract water from your property.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to remove as much water as possible, reducing the risk of secondary damage and further complications.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air. This step is critical in preventing water damage and mold growth. Our team will work to ensure your property is thoroughly dried and restored to its original condition.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ection
We’ll use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to remove dirt, grime, and bacteria. Our team will also apply disinfectants to prevent the growth of mold and mildew. This step is essential in restoring your property to a safe and healthy condition.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Repair
We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ure everything is complete and up to code. Our team will make any necessary repairs and provide a final report outlining the work completed. We’ll also provide recommendations for future maintenance and prevention.

Standing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Water damage from a burst pipe |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age. |
| Minor water spill on hardwood floor | Yes | No | A simple mop and fan can handle small spills. |
| Water damage from a flooded basement |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and health risks. |

Standing Water Extraction Cost in Middleton, ID
The cost of Standing Water Extraction in Middleton, ID var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on average costs and may vary depending on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ment used. |
| Dehumidification and air circulation | $200 – $1,000 | Duration of service, equipment used, and local conditions. |

How can I prevent Standing Water Extraction in the future?
We recommend regular maintenance, such as inspecting your pipes and appliances for leaks, and keeping your property clean and dry. You can also consider installing a sump pump or backup power source to prevent future issues.
